Whether you are looking for new ideas or want to refresh your knowledge, this site provides guidance and information about opportunities to develop and enhance your digital practice. ‘Digital practice’ refers to how we use digital technologies for education, research and work - an area of great importance in a constantly evolving digital world.

Browse the teaching and learning guides, explore current development and training opportunities from Organisational Development & Professional Learning (OD&PL) and find practical support for using specific tools and systems.

If you are looking to develop your digital practice for work, research or education, but are not sure where to start, the Digital Literacy Framework can support you to develop your digital skills by establishing objectives and managing your digital literacy plan.
